The Mechanics Behind the Spin

At first glance, pokies might seem like mere chance machines, but a closer inspection reveals a complex interplay of algorithms and odds. Random Number Generators (RNGs) ensure that every spin is independent, yet the Return to Player (RTP) percentages can vary widely. Understanding these mechanics can mean the difference between a frustrating session and a strategically enjoyable experience.

Exploring Different Types of Online Pokies

Not all pokies are cut from the same cloth. Some players prefer classic three-reel slots that evoke the feel of vintage machines, while others dive into video pokies packed with bonus rounds, free spins, and interactive features. Then there are progressive jackpots, where the prize pool swells with every bet placed, tempting players with life-changing sums.

  • Classic Pokies: Simple, nostalgic, and easy to grasp.
  • Video Pokies: Feature-rich with engaging storylines and graphics.
  • Progressive Jackpots: High stakes with potentially massive payouts.
  • Branded Slots: Based on popular movies, TV shows, or celebrities.

Table: Comparing Pokie Types by Key Features

Pokie Type Reels Bonus Features Typical RTP Range Player Appeal
Classic 3 Minimal or none 92% – 96% Traditionalists, beginners
Video 5+ Free spins, multipliers, mini-games 94% – 97% Casual and experienced players
Progressive Jackpot Varies Jackpot triggers, bonus rounds 88% – 95% High-risk, high-reward seekers
Branded 5+ Themed bonuses, storylines 93% – 96% Fans of franchises, collectors

Common Misconceptions About Online Pokies

Many players fall into the trap of believing that pokies are rigged or that certain machines are ‘due’ for a win. While the RNG ensures fairness, the illusion of patterns can mislead even the sharpest minds. Recognizing these myths helps maintain a healthy perspective and prevents chasing losses in vain.
